Transaction 3dcaea54ddba371f13628fbd7485748febcd26e9d492cdecbae6712d2cb1aeb3
1 Input
2 Outputs
- 3dcaea54ddba371f13628fbd7485748febcd26e9d492cdecbae6712d2cb1aeb3:0
- 3dcaea54ddba371f13628fbd7485748febcd26e9d492cdecbae6712d2cb1aeb3:1
value 70000000
address 1E3s2YA5SQsVeRZWPV18MC44KXvWDzKvZM
value 3648020
address 123HUvguvRERWAo7vhrqe5gLrn12tBojQR